JRAD is seeking candidates for DGRS Intergovernmental Affairs Specialist supporting ARPA-H.
This position is located in Washington, D.C.

Roles/Responsibilities:
 Research, identify, track USG funded programs and conduct cross walk with ARPA-H
programs and program manager concepts to identify agency outreach targets
 Identify key programs in relation to ARPA-H programs/mission, and leadership points of
contact within each of the agencies/programs
 Build and maintain relationships with USG points of contact
 Capture data into Intergovernmental tracking system
 Create and maintain a dashboard of HHS interagency engagements and programs
 Draft reports on ARPA-H engagement or on potential opportunities as required
 Create presentations tailored to agency/divisions, support outreach and scheduling with
agency contacts as required

Required Skills and Education:
 2-4 years experience with identifying government funding or grants opportunities
 2-4 years working with or in the federal government and/or engagement with the
executive branch
 2-4 years experience in outreach and engagement with government and/or corporate
SMEs, leadership
 Experience with contracts research, management tracking tools
 Must be detailed, diplomatic, with excellent communication, research, and writing skills,
and flexible to juggle various projects at once
 Advanced skills in PowerPoint, Excel, etc., and other related presentation and tracking
software tools
 Bachelor’s degree

Desired Experience:
 2-3 years in an ARPA setting

Security Clearance:
 Public Trust
